Pulaski County Auditor Sheila Garling posed a question to the county commissioners at their meeting yesterday. When computers need maintenance, who pays for it?

Garling had recently had two computers fixed on-site by DeGroot Technology, with the costs of $149.99 and $184.99. Because of the fact that she never knows when this kind of work is necessary and she understands that not all departments can afford those kind of bills, Garling was not sure whether the bill could be paid out of the budget set aside for DeGroot or if a different budget is used.

Since all departments have computers, Commissioner Ken Boswell recommended merging all computer repair bills into one budget. After a brief discussion, the commissioners decided that was a great idea; unfortunately, it wouldn’t be effective until next year. In the meantime, the bills will have to be paid out of funds that are currently available to the department.
